#5e6883 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e6883 is composed of 36.9% red, 40.8%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 20.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 223.8 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#5e6883 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cd0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#5e6883 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#5e6883 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e6883 has RGB values of R:94, G:104,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6187139.

Shades and Tints of #5e6883
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040405 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e6883
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7072 is the less saturated color, while #0740da is the most saturated one.
